Oppo A76 Renders, Leaked Specs: Will ship with Snapdragon 680 SoC and 5000mAh battery

Oppo is gearing up to launch the successor to the Oppo A74, the Oppo A76. The upcoming device from Oppo will be a budget phone and could cost less than $200. The 91mobiles report details the specs, renders, and design of the device.

Based on the leaked images, the Oppo A76 will have a selfie camera cutout, side-mounted fingerprint sensor, and dual cameras on the back. It can pack a Snapdragon 680 SoC under the hood and a 5000mAh battery. Let’s take a look at the leaked Oppo A76 specs, images and price.

Oppo A76 leaked specs and renders

The image released in the report hints that the Oppo A76 will have a dual camera setup on the back with LED flash. It will be available in two color options – blue and black. On the left is the volume rocker and SIM tray, while on the right is the power button with an integrated fingerprint sensor. On the front, it will have a cutout for the front camera and narrow bezels. The phone will measure 164.4 x 75.7 x 8.4mm and weigh 189 grams.

The Oppo A76 will feature a 6.56-inch HD+ display with a resolution of 1612 x 720 pixels. It is said to support 90Hz refresh rate. The device will be powered by Snapdragon 680 chipset which will be paired with Adreno 610 GPU for video and gaming. It will run ColorOS 11.1 based on Android 11 out of the box. The device will pack a 5,000mAh battery with support for 33W fast charging.

In terms of optics, it will have a dual rear camera setup that will feature a 13MP main sensor and a 2MP secondary lens. Selfies and video calls will be handled by the 8-megapixel front camera.

The report shows that the Oppo A76 will be available in two storage options – 4GB + 128GB and 6GB + 128GB. The device memory can be expanded using a microSD card.
